Entry Level Train Ai roles focus on preparing datasets for AI models, often requiring basic technical skills and collaboration with AI teams. Data Annotators primarily label data to ensure quality training data, with similar credentials but a more specific focus on data accuracy. Both roles are essential in AI development but differ in scope and daily tasks.
